This is always the most difficult dilemma I confront in life. Aim for diversity and variety: that Saw marathon may provide gore but doesn't really capture the Halloween spirit. Same goes for Universal Monsters in succession, they'll start running together. Alternate periods (silent, classic, modern, contemporary) and horror sub-genres (zombies, monsters, slashers) and you'll have a satisfying casserole of horror on Halloween.
